Los Angeles Coroner Thomas Noguchi reported that the fatal shot was fired at close range from RFK’s rear, and that ballistics and witnesses all said Sirhan never got closer than a couple feet to RFK’s front.
RFK’s bodyguard Thane Caesar lied to the police about his possession that night of a handgun, and it was his clip-on tie which was grabbed and held by RFK when he was on the pantry floor.
Key evidence such as ceiling tiles and door jambs, which would evidence more bullets were fired than the capacity of Sirhan’s gun alone, were destroyed by the LAPD.
